- [ ] **Step 7: Breaker override escrow.** After sealing the signing keys for the Tallgrove upstream API circuit breaker, confirm the support team can force the breaker open during a full outage. The override bundle lives in the sealed escrow drawer and is useless without its unlock phrase. Two ceremony witnesses must initial this step before proceeding. The escrow bundle is decrypted with the recovery passphrase that follows.

vault phrase of kahip-kahop = holath-quenmir

## Legacy Pricing Update — Managers Only

Heads up, team: starting next quarter, legacy Brightvale customers on the old Corvid plans will see a 9% uplift. Comms go out three weeks ahead, and support scripts are being refreshed by Marla's group. Expect some churn noise from the Kettleworth accounts — hold the line, but escalate anything over 200 seats to me. Don't share numbers outside this group. The context below explains why this matters.

board note of bahif-yajef: Only 9 of the 120 pilot accounts renewed Oliwyn, so a churn review is set for January 1.

# Gateline Environments

Gateline counts turnstile entries at the Ashvale arena. Three environments: dev (synthetic pulses), staging (replayed match-day traffic), prod (live hardware links). Contractors get dev and staging only. Counts in staging lag real time by design — don't file bugs for that. Prod changes go through Marek's review, no exceptions, because a bad deploy on match day means manual gate counts. Staging resets every Monday; expect empty dashboards after the wipe. Each environment runs the same binary with the configuration below.

service settings:
PRAWYN_PIN=9848
PRAWYN_METRICS_HOST=metrics.prawyn.lumicworks.corp
PRAWYN_LOG_LEVEL=warn
PRAWYN_TENANT=pelius

# Gridloader Environments

Gridloader, the CSV import wizard, runs in sandbox and production. Support should reproduce customer issues in sandbox first — it accepts the same file formats but caps uploads at 10MB and sends no notification emails. Production imports are queued through the Marrow scheduler and can lag during month-end. The sandbox environment uses the following configuration values.

service settings:
[casax]
port = 6379
team = rusir
host = casax.zemvarhq.corp
region = outer-4
access_code = ac_9808ce
timeout_ms = 1500